Read Online the Free Book “Fundamentals of Computer Programming with C#” (the Bulgarian Book)

Preface

Chapter 1. Introduction to Programming

Chapter 2. Primitive Types and Variables

Chapter 3. Operators and Expressions

Chapter 4. Console Input and Output

Chapter 5. Conditional Statements

Chapter 6. Loops

Chapter 7. Arrays

Chapter 8. Numeral Systems

Chapter 9. Methods

Chapter 10. Recursion

Chapter 11. Creating and Using Objects

Chapter 12. Exception Handling

Chapter 13. Strings and Text Processing

Chapter 14. Defining Classes

Chapter 15. Text Files

Chapter 16. Linear Data Structures

Chapter 17. Trees and Graphs

Chapter 18. Dictionaries, Hash-Tables and Sets

Chapter 19. Data Structures and Algorithm Complexity

Chapter 20. Object-Oriented Programming Principles

Chapter 21. High-Quality Programming Code

Chapter 22. Lambda Expressions and LINQ

Chapter 23. Methodology of Problem Solving

Chapter 24. Sample Programming Exam – Topic #1

Chapter 25. Sample Programming Exam – Topic #2

Chapter 26. Sample Programming Exam – Topic #3

Conclusion

Share
Tags: , , , , , , , , , , , , , , , , , , , , , , , , , , , , , , , , , , , , , , , , , , , , , , ,

37 responses to “Read Online the Free Book “Fundamentals of Computer Programming with C#” (the Bulgarian Book)”

  1. […] am really glad to say, that the book “Fundamentals of Computer Programming with C#” has been translated in […]

  2. […] “Fundamentals of Computer Programming with C#” now in English. Free for downloading and reading online. Thanks to Svetlin Nakov and his team of software […]

  3. […] You can Download the C# book in PDF (13,7 MB)  or   Read the C# book online […]

  4. […] Fundamentals of Computer Programming with C# – Svetlin Nakov […]

  5. function addErrorMessage(id, msg) { var selector = "#" + id; $(selector).removeClass("field-validation-valid").addClass("field-validation-error").html(msg); } function hideErrorMessage(id) { var selector = "#" + id; $(selector).removeClass("field-validati says:

    load demo

    body {
    font-size: 12px;
    font-family: Arial;
    }

    Footer navigation:

    $( “#new-nav” ).load( “/ #jq-footerNavigation li” );

    • function addErrorMessage(id, msg) { var selector = "#" + id; $(selector).removeClass("field-validation-valid").addClass("field-validation-error").html(msg); } function hideErrorMessage(id) { var selector = "#" + id; $(selector).removeClass("field-validati says:

      load demo

      body {
      font-size: 12px;
      font-family: Arial;
      }

      Footer navigation:

      $( “#new-nav” ).load( “/ #jq-footerNavigation li” );

      load demo

      body {
      font-size: 12px;
      font-family: Arial;
      }

      Footer navigation:

      $( “#new-nav” ).load( “/ #jq-footerNavigation li” );

  6. […] Fundamentals of Computer Programming with C# – Svetlin Nakov […]

  7. MT6 says:

    I love this book. Now i am in page number 104. This is written in very simple english and you can easily get start with C# 😀

  8. Tom says:

    Hey! I understand this is sort of off-topic but I had to ask.
    Does building a well-established blog like yours require a large amount of work?
    I am completely new to running a blog but I
    do write in my diary daily. I’d like to start a blog so I can easily share my own experience and thoughts online.
    Please let me know if you have any kind of suggestions or tips for new aspiring bloggers.
    Appreciate it!

  9. Nice post. I learn something totally new and challenging on sites I stumbleupon everyday.
    It’s always helpful to read articles from other authors and practice something from their sites.

  10. biyang spray says:

    It’s in reality a great and useful piece of information. I am happy that you just shared this helpful
    info with us. Please stay us informed like this. Thanks for sharing.

  11. Lyndon says:

    Write more, thats all I have to say. Literally, it seems
    as though you relied on the video to make your point. You definitely know what youre talking about, why waste your intelligence on just
    posting videos to your blog when you could be giving us something informative to read?

  12. We’re a group of volunteers and starting a brand new scheme in our community.
    Your web site offered us with useful info to work on. You’ve performed
    an impressive task and our whole neighborhood can be grateful to you.

  13. Hi there mates, how is everything, and what you would like to say about this
    post, in my view its in fact awesome in support of me.

  14. Hi there it’s me, I am also visiting this web page daily, this web page
    is actually nice and the people are actually sharing pleasant thoughts.

  15. Just desire to say your article is as astonishing. The clarity
    for your put up is just spectacular and that i
    can think you are knowledgeable on this subject. Well
    along with your permission allow me to grasp your RSS
    feed to keep updated with coming near near post. Thanks 1,000,000 and please
    carry on the gratifying work.

  16. Good day! Would you mind if I share your blog with my twitter
    group? There’s a lot of folks that I think would really appreciate your content.
    Please let me know. Thank you

    Feel free to surf to my site :: homelink garage door opener

  17. For most recent information you have to pay a visit world wide web and on world-wide-web I found this web
    page as a finest web site for hottest updates.

  18. hijab style says:

    An intriguing discussion is definitely worth comment.
    I do believe that you need to write more about this topic, it might not be a taboo subject but typically folks don’t talk about such subjects.
    To the next! Cheers!!

  19. Excellent post. I was checking constantly this blog and I am impressed!

    Very useful information particularly the last
    part 🙂 I care for such information much. I was looking for this particular
    info for a long time. Thank you and good luck.

  20. Pretty! This has been an extremely wonderful post.
    Many thanks for providing this information.

  21. Every weekend i used to visit this web site, as i want
    enjoyment, since this this website conations
    in fact good funny data too.

  22. Hi, the whole thing is going sound here and ofcourse every one
    is sharing facts, that’s genuinely good, keep up writing.

  23. King says:

    Hi,i have been grateful for a good work done. Am impressed with the soft copy you and your group put in place for people who want to be part takers (take part) in programming and writing code. i wish to contact you on your e-mail personally for discussion.thank and will be waiting for a reply.

  24. RodneysKa says:

    jrpjcwebeimunqzvwhtfa kwdpxjx aqbrrrb raelkvs

  25. Olumide says:

    Thank you so much for this book.

  26. […] Fundamentals of Computer Programming with C# – Svetlin Nakov […]

  27. […] Fundamentals of Computer Programming with C# – Svetlin Nakov […]

  28. […] Fundamentals of Computer Programming with C# – Svetlin Nakov […]

  29. LitSol inc. says:

    […] Fundamentals of Computer Programming with C# — Svetlin Nakov […]

  30. أين النسخه العربيه؟

Leave a Reply

Your email address will not be published.